Cape Verde to Tunisia Visa Requirements (2026)
For Cape Verde passport holders travelling to Tunisia, no visa is required.

Do Cape Verde citizens need a visa for Tunisia?
Visa-Free. For Cape Verde passport holders, no visa is required.
How long can Cape Verde passport holders stay in Tunisia?
Under the current rules, Cape Verde citizens may stay in Tunisia for up to 90 days. Confirm the exact permitted duration with border officials, as it can vary by purpose of travel.
